#ifndef __com_sun_star_sdbcx_Table_idl__
#define __com_sun_star_sdbcx_Table_idl__

#ifndef __com_sun_star_beans_XPropertySet_idl__
#include <com/sun/star/beans/XPropertySet.idl>
#endif

 module com {  module sun {  module star {  module sdbcx {

 published interface XDataDescriptorFactory;
 published interface XColumnsSupplier;
 published interface XIndexesSupplier;
 published interface XKeysSupplier;
 published interface XRename;
 published interface XAlterTable;


/** used to specify a table in a database. A table is described by its
    name and one or more columns.

    <p>
    In addition, it may contain indexes to improve the performance in
    the retrieval of the table's data and keys, and to define semantic rules for the table.
    </p>
    <p>
    <b>
    Note:
    </b>
    All properties and columns of a table could by modified before
    it is appended to a database. In that case, the service is in fact a
    descriptor. On existing tables, a user might alter columns, add or delete
    columns, indexes, and keys depending on the capabilities of the database and on
    the user's privileges.
    </p>

    @see com::sun::star::sdbc::XDatabaseMetaData
    @see com::sun::star::sdbcx::Privilege
 */
published service Table
{

    /** optional, could be used to copy an table.
     */
    [optional] interface XDataDescriptorFactory;


    /** access to the contained table columns.
     */
    interface XColumnsSupplier;


    /** optional, provides the access of the table indexes.
     */
    [optional] interface XIndexesSupplier;


    /** optional, provides the access to the table keys.
     */
    [optional] interface XKeysSupplier;


    /** optional, allows the renaming of tables.
     */
    [optional] interface XRename;


    /** optional, allows the altering of columns.
     */
    [optional] interface XAlterTable;

    // gives access to the properties
    interface com::sun::star::beans::XPropertySet;


    /** is the name of the table.
     */
    [readonly, property] string Name;


    /** is the name of the table catalog.
     */
    [readonly, property] string CatalogName;


    /** is the name of the table schema.
     */
    [readonly, property] string SchemaName;


    /** supplies a comment on the table. Could be empty, if not supported by
        the driver.
     */
    [readonly, property] string Description;


    /** indicates the type of the table like (TABLE, VIEW, SYSTEM TABLE).
        Could be empty, if not supported by the driver.
     */
    [optional, readonly, property] string Type;
};

//=============================================================================

}; }; }; };

/*===========================================================================
===========================================================================*/
#endif
